...
近年来,比特币作为一种新兴的数字货币迅速崛起,吸引了大量投资者和用户的关注。而在这些用户中,越来越多的人开始意识到安全性的重要性。比特币多重签名钱包应运而生,为用户提供了更高的安全性和资金管理的灵活性。本文将详细探讨比特币多重签名钱包的使用方法以及其附带的安全优势。
### 什么是多重签名钱包?多重签名钱包是一种需要多个签名才能进行交易的加密货币钱包。简单来说,当你创建这样一个钱包时,可以设定多位参与者并规定在进行任何交易时需要多少人签署才能完成。这种机制旨在增强资金安全性。
与传统比特币钱包只需要一个私钥进行操作不同,多重签名钱包需要多个签名。这意味着即使一个私钥被盗,盗贼也无法轻易访问钱包中的资金,从而提供了一层额外的保护。
### 为何选择多重签名钱包?由于多重签名钱包需要多个私钥签名,盗贼无法通过获取单一私钥来获取资金,显著提高了资金的安全性。
对于企业或团队而言,资金管理尤为复杂,通过多重签名钱包可以指定多个负责人,提升团队的透明程度,并确保资金的合理使用。
如果只有一个密钥管理资金,一旦该密钥丢失或被盗,所有资金将面临风险。多重签名钱包可以通过设置多个签名,避免这种单点故障的发生。
### 多重签名钱包的工作原理在比特币系统中,每个用户都有一对公钥和私钥。公钥相当于银行账号,任何人都可以用它回复给你比特币;而私钥则是访问这些比特币的钥匙,只有拥有私钥的人才能使用钱包中的资金。
每次进行交易时,系统会根据参与者的公钥生成一个交易签名。这些签名会被合并,形成一个有效的交易,满足设置的签名数量条件,完成后方可执行交易。
最常用的多重签名算法包括Pay-to-Script-Hash (P2SH)等。P2SH允许用户把多个条件或规则存储在一个地址中,这种灵活性是多重签名钱包的一项重要优势。
### 如何创建比特币多重签名钱包?首先,用户需要选择一个支持多重签名功能的钱包软件。常见的选项包括Electrum、Armory等。
在钱包软件中,选择设置多重签名地址的选项,输入参与者的数量以及需要的签名数量。例如,三人团队中可能会设置2/3的签名要求。
在需要添加参与者的界面中,输入所有需要参与交易的成员的公钥。这是确保参与者可以合法签署交易的基础。
设置完毕后,确认所有参数后即可创建钱包。此时,系统会生成一个多重签名地址,可用于接收和发送比特币。
### 多重签名钱包的使用方法接收比特币和传统钱包类似,用户只需提供生成的多重签名地址即可。无论有多少参与者,使用同一个地址接收比特币是安全的。
发送比特币相对复杂,因为需要多个参与者进行签名。用户在发送比特币时需确保满足设定的签名条件,即确定所有参与者是否在场并进行签名。
在处理交易时,需要仔细检查所有签名及参与者是否确认。如果有人缺席或存在疏漏,交易将无法完成,需等待所有参与者签名才能完成。
### 常见问题解答多重签名钱包通过要求多个签名操作,大幅提高了安全性。即使一个私钥泄露,攻击者仍然无法轻易获得用户的资金。此外,参与者可以自行决定谁是可签名的人,从而增强了透明度。
是的,用户只要保留好创建时的公钥就可以恢复钱包。但是,私钥的管理至关重要,需确保不遗失或泄露。
多重签名钱包的使用费用与常规比特币交易类似,但因为需要多个签名的过程,可能在网络繁忙时导致处理时间变长,但费用大致相同。
选择参与者时需考虑信任度,与团队的业务需求、职责相关的人选。理想情况下,选择可靠且能够有效沟通的人负责相关事务。
建立明确的内部流程,定期审核交易,确保每次交易都有记录。配合智能合约技术,可条件性设定也能进一步确保资金不会被滥用。
日常操作需确保参与者对交易的信息透明,并在每次交易前,确保所有必要的签名均已完成,避免潜在错误的发生。
### 结论比特币多重签名钱包为用户提供了一个安全、高效的资金管理工具。通过加强权限控制和签名安全性,它不仅可以促进个人使用,更适合团队和企业用户。而随着技术的发展和区块链技术的不断完善,多重签名钱包的未来前景也将更加广阔。希望本文能帮助更多用户理解如何有效使用多重签名钱包,以确保其数字资产的安全。